Output 6bfeb251e1663b929f679ab800085d3b0778f2e45a2750f5f33d81b9a8d7f964:10

value
69512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31602bfc3f65071c67812b90af4185a6afe9660a OP_EQUAL
address
36C6F5WHPbZqhmoTYkH8F8WGvyP6v6x1fs
transaction
6bfeb251e1663b929f679ab800085d3b0778f2e45a2750f5f33d81b9a8d7f964
spent
true